Optimization lies at the core of modern science, engineering, and decision-making, providing
systematic methods to identify the best possible solutions under given constraints. This book presents
a comprehensive and integrated treatment of optimization, beginning with foundational concepts and
mathematical prerequisites and progressing through linear, nonlinear, combinatorial, dynamic,
stochastic, and convex optimization frameworks. Emphasis is placed on both theoretical
understanding and algorithmic implementation, ensuring that readers not only grasp underlying
principles but also learn how to apply them to real-world problems. Historical developments are
interwoven with contemporary methods to highlight the evolution of optimization as a discipline.
Each chapter is structured to balance rigor with intuition, supported by classical examples,
algorithms, and practical applications across engineering, economics, artificial intelligence, and the
natural sciences. Designed for students, researchers, and practitioners, this book aims to build strong
conceptual foundations while also introducing advanced topics and emerging frontiers. Ultimately, it
seeks to cultivate analytical thinking and equip readers with versatile optimization tools for solving
complex, real-world challenges.
